• To improve the taste of your dishes ideally complement the type of pasta with sauce. The thin, delicate pastas like spaghetti fine must be served with light sauces. Instead thick pasta such as fettuccine combined with strong sauces. The pasta shapes that have holes like penne rigate, spiral, boom, short macaroni, etcetera. Heavy sauces are delicious and meaty. |

• Carbohydrates or carbohydrate carbon are in the fruit, vegetables, cereal grains and their derivatives, such as bread, pasta, flour and, to some extent, vegetables. There is no doubt that we need carbs to live. For example, the brain uses glucose as its main carbohydrate source of energy. |
